Perfectly Price Elastic
A market scenario where the demand for a product is extremely sensitive to changes in price, meaning consumers will stop buying the product if the price increases even slightly.
Demand Curve
A graphical representation of the relationship between the price of a good and the quantity demanded by consumers at various prices.
